''Junji Ito's Cat Diary: Yon & Mu'' (''Itō Junji no Neko Nikki: Yon & Mū'') is a manga by famous horror manga author Creator/JunjiIto.

to:

''Junji Ito's Cat Diary: Yon & Mu'' (''Itō Junji no Neko Nikki: Yon & Mū'') is a manga by famous horror manga author Creator/JunjiIto.
Creator/JunjiIto. The manga was serialized in ''Monthly Magazine Z'' from 2008 to 2009, with its chapters compiled into a single volume.
